64-bit Processors in Brief

64-bit Processors is an adjective used to indicate the Microarchitecture of CPU and ALU to describe the registers, address buses or data buses and as whole instructions of 64 bits (8 octets). What is Radio-frequency Identification (RFID)?

Radio-frequency Identification or RFID uses the help of electromagnetic waves the allows automatic identification and localization of objects and living beings.
